Australian Gold Continuous Spray SunscreenSPF refers to 'sun protection factor' and is a measure of the amount of solar radiation required to produce a burn on protected skin versus the amount required to produce a burn on nonprotected skin," Marcus explained. "So, it is still possible to tan or burn with sunscreen on, but it takes a larger dose of UV radiation to do so." The thing is, even just those unprotected 10 or 15 minutes are way more than enough time to cause DNA damage, and every bit of this damage adds up throughout your lifetime, producing more and more genetic mutations that keep increasing your lifetime risk of skin cancer. Unfortunately, the very same UVB wavelengths (290-320 nanometers, or nm) that make the body synthesize vitamin D are also the wavelengths that produce sunburn and genetic mutations that can lead to skin cancer. The SPF number, or sun protection factor, of a sunscreen, only refers to the amount of time needed for your unprotected skin to turn pink after going out in the sun. A higher number means it’ll take longer for your skin to get burned than a sunscreen with lower SPF.

The best way to avoid this and prevent any unnecessary sun damage is by self-tanning the evening before, washing off the guide colour just before you go to sleep, and then leaving your skin overnight to allow the DHA to fully develop. Then, in the next morning, you can apply your sunscreen to any areas which will be exposed during the day, with confidence that you’re staying safe.
